
Essential Steps After a Storm: How to Address Roof Damage
Storm damage to your roof can feel overwhelming, but knowing the steps to take can make the process manageable. Homeowners often overlook that even minor storms can inflict serious damage. If you've experienced severe weather recently, here’s what you should do next.
Step 1: Schedule a Roof Inspection With a Local Expert
The first action on your checklist should be to get a professional roof inspection. A trustworthy roofing company can assess both surface and damage hidden beneath debris. With their trained eye, they will identify which parts are compromised and need immediate attention. Understanding the degree of damage is crucial for your next steps.
Step 2: Contact Your Insurance Provider
After determining the condition of your roof, reach out to your insurance provider to initiate a claim. Generally, homeowners insurance will cover roof damage caused by storms, but knowing the specifics of your policy is essential.
Step 3: Make Emergency Repairs
While you wait for the insurance claims process to unfold, take proactive steps to limit further damage. Simple actions like roof tarping can prevent leaks, and it’s often best to have a contractor handle such emergency repairs to ensure quick and safe fixes.
The Importance of Insurance Claims Approval
Once your insurance company evaluates your claim, they may often undercut the coverage based on initial assessments. It's crucial to advocate for yourself and, if necessary, enlist your contractor to discuss the claim further with the insurance adjuster. This can lead to better overall coverage and effective repairs.
Step 5: Proceed With Repairs or Replacement
Once your claim is approved, your contractor can begin the repairs or replacement work. Whether you need a simple fix or a complete replacement, having a reliable contractor on your side will ease the transition back to a secure and functional home.
